30 ANNETTE ROAD is a very small extended semi-detached house of 62m², built sometime between 1967 and 1975, which could now be worth an estimated £154,906. It was last sold for £107,050 in September 2007, which was about the average September 2007 semi-detached price in the Stoke-on-Trent local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was September 2011,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might 30 ANNETTE ROAD be worth now?

30 ANNETTE ROAD might now be worth an estimated £154,906.

This is based on house price inflation of 44.7%, between September 2007 and February 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Stoke-on-Trent local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 44.7%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 30 ANNETTE ROAD of £107,050 on 13th September 2007. For the value to have increased from £107,050 to £154,906 over the eighteen years and seven months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 30 ANNETTE ROAD has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Stoke-on-Trent local authority area.
  • The September 2007 sale price of £107,050 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 30 ANNETTE ROAD has not materially changed since September 2007.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.

30 ANNETTE ROAD: Plot and Title Map

30 ANNETTE ROAD sits on a plot of roughly 0.045 of an acre, or 184m². The below map shows the location of 30 ANNETTE ROAD,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 30 ANNETTE ROAD).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
